Hadji and his two crime paertners, Sean and Gee, are three yung hustlers from the gritty streets of Wilson (a.k.a. Wide-A-Wake), where jealousy, hate envy and betrayal rules over everything and will bring the strongest of men down ay any moment.
When Hadji finally meets the woman of his dreams and decides that he wants out of the game and tries to pass the torch down to his main man Gee, something or someone always seem to pull him back in deeper and deeper. Will he be able to beat the odds and make it out of the game before it's to late, or by being GREEDY, cause him to lose everything he worled so hard to get and discover the true meaning of "The Enemy Within?"
